Greek Yogurt Fruit Parfaits Finished with a Spearmint Olive Oil Blend Honey Drizzle

Creamy Greek yogurt, juicy berries, toasted granola, and a bright honey drizzle come together in a fresh parfait that feels cheerful, colorful, and easy to spoon up anytime.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Total Time 15 minutes
Servings: 4 parfaits
Course: Breakfast, Brunch, Desserts, Snacks
Cuisine: Fusion Cuisine, Greek, Mediterranean

Ingredients

  • 2 cups plain Greek yogurt
  • 1 cup fresh strawberries hulled and sliced
  • 1 cup fresh blueberries
  • 1 cup fresh raspberries
  • 1 cup granola
  • 3 tablespoons honey
  • 1 tablespoon Spearmint Infused Olive Oil
  • 1 teaspoon fresh lemon zest
  • 1 tablespoon chopped fresh mint
  • Pinch of fine sea salt

Method
 

Instructions
  1. In a small bowl, whisk together the honey, Spearmint Infused Olive Oil, lemon zest, chopped mint, and a pinch of sea salt until smooth.
  2. Spoon a layer of Greek yogurt into each glass or bowl.
  3. Add a layer of strawberries, blueberries, raspberries, and granola.
  4. Repeat the layers once more, finishing with fruit on top.
  5. Drizzle the spearmint honey mixture over each parfait just before serving.
  6. Serve right away for the best mix of creamy, juicy, and crunchy textures.

Notes

For the cleanest layers, dry the berries well after washing and keep the granola separate until the last minute. The spearmint olive oil should taste bright and herbal, so add it gradually if you want a lighter drizzle. Best served soon after assembly for the nicest texture contrast.
